Abstract

The invention discloses a kind of new weight bench based on compression spring, including substrate, bed body and two support meanss, support meanss include bottom plate, top plate, sliding block and balancing weight, two the first guide pillars being parallel to each other are connected between the bottom plate and top plate, the sliding block is passed through by two the first guide pillars, the top plate lower surface is fixedly connected with two the second guide pillars being parallel to each other, the balancing weight is passed through by two the second guide pillars, the bottom of each second guide pillar is fixed with a block, a limited block is fixed with each first guide pillar, two limited blocks are located at below the sliding block, and two limited blocks are located at same level height, the first compression spring is connected between the top plate and sliding block, the second compression spring is connected between the balancing weight and the sliding block;Connecting rod is connected between two sliding blocks.The weight bench of the present invention, it is safer, it is more beneficial for grasping training effect.

Background technology
With the improvement of living standards, attention degree more and more higher of the people for health, many men like body-building Room body-building.Existing gymnasium can usually be equipped with weight bench, for training arm strength, but existing weight bench will one accompany Practice, the people otherwise trained is once short of physical strength, easily caused danger.And existing weight bench, which has been lifted, to be needed to write from memory at heart several times Number, and weight lifting is nonstandard sometimes, oneself counts and does not remember clearly.

A kind of weight bench, including substrate 3, bed body 4 and two support meanss, the bed body positioned at two support meanss it Between, the support meanss include bottom plate 1.1, top plate 1.2, sliding block 1.3 and balancing weight 1.5, are connected between the bottom plate and top plate There are two the first guide pillars 1 being parallel to each other, the sliding block 1.3 is passed through by two the first guide pillars 1, and the top plate lower surface, which is fixed, to be connected Two the second guide pillars 2 being parallel to each other are connected to, the balancing weight 1.5 is passed through by two the second guide pillars 2, the bottom of each second guide pillar End is fixed with a block 2.1, a limited block 1.4 is fixed with each first guide pillar, two limited blocks 1.4 are located at the cunning Below block, and two limited blocks are located at same level height, and the first compression spring 1.6 is connected between the top plate and sliding block, The second compression spring 1.7 is connected between the balancing weight and the sliding block;The bed body includes supporting leg 4.1, the support Leg and two bottom plates are both secured on the substrate 3;Connecting rod 5 is connected between two sliding blocks.It is cased with preventing in the connecting rod 5 Sliding sleeve 5.1.The top plate lower surface is fixed with cylindrical portion 1.2.1, and the upper surface of the sliding block is fixed with lower cylindrical portion 1.3.1.The axis collinear of the upper and lower cylindrical portion, and the external diameter of the lower cylindrical portion is less than the internal diameter of the upper cylindrical portion.Institute When stating sliding block abutting limited block, first and second spring is in compressive state.Each support meanss have sliding block, one Individual balancing weight, a top plate, a bottom plate, two the first guide pillars, two the second guide pillars, two limited blocks and two blocks;Institute Supporting leg and the bottom plate is stated to be welded and fixed with the substrate.
As illustrated, trainer catches the upward weight lifting of Anti-slip cover, first and second compression spring is downwardly applied to reaction force, can To play a part of similar Lifting barbell.If only designing a compression spring, the strength of starting needs of weight lifting can be caused too It is small, it is very big with true weight lifting difference.Design two compression springs so that the power that the starting point of weight lifting needs is with regard to bigger, follow-up institute The strength needed slowly increases, and is advantageous to train arm strength.And even if trainer is short of physical strength, Anti-slip cover is unclamped, sliding block can fall To limited block, injury will not be produced to trainer.
In order to facilitate counting, in addition to touch-screen and controller, two support meanss are respectively the first support meanss and Two support meanss;The top plate lower surface of first support meanss is provided with laser range sensor 10, and the laser ranging passes Sensor is used to measure the laser range sensor to the distance of balancing weight upper surface;Two blocks of first support meanss The upper surface of one of block there is mounting groove, pressure sensor is installed in the mounting groove;The touch-screen, laser Distance measuring sensor, pressure sensor are connected with the controller;The controller can control the touch-screen display training behaviour Make interface, the training operation interface includes starting to train button, terminates training button, weight lifting total degree and standard weight lifting time Count, the display numeral of the weight lifting total degree is to start after training button is pressed and terminate before training button to be pressed, laser The measured value of distance measuring sensor be less than given threshold number (although as shown in figure 3, now sliding block is picked up, balancing weight Be not picked up also, weight lifting is simultaneously nonstandard), the display of standard weight lifting number numeral for start to train button be pressed after and Terminate before training button is pressed, the number that the measured value of pressure sensor is zero is (as shown in figure 4, now not only sliding block is lifted Rise, balancing weight is also picked up, weight lifting standard.);When the measured value of laser range sensor is from the state more than or equal to given threshold When changing into the state less than given threshold, it is designated as once;When the measured value of pressure sensor changes into zero from non-zero values, It is designated as once.The given threshold is A-10cm;When the A is that the sliding block abuts the limited block, the laser ranging passes The measured value of sensor.
Described to terminate after training button to be pressed, the display numeral of the weight lifting total degree and standard weight lifting number is Zero.So end training button can be pressed so as to which numeral be reset after terminating to train.
The total degree of weight lifting and the number of standard weight lifting so can be intuitively shown, trainer is more beneficial for and grasps training Effect.
